Some of my friends were at an auction and picked up a Fluke 714B Thermocouple calibrator because they thought it looked like something i might be able to use.

I have little experience with calibrators, but it looks like a tool that could be useful for troubleshooting. It appears like it can measure Ma, which would be handy.

Have others been using these and have had good successs? I am a fan of Fluke in multimeters, they work great!

What all can we do with this tool?
 
You can manage to miscalibrate temperature devices if you are not careful about how the calibrator is used with its jack/leadwire adapter.

Any thermocouple calibrator can report or generate incorrect values if its cold junction (CJ) (ice point) sensor has not adjusted to the thermocouple jack connection temperature.

You must use the correct type thermocouple jack/lead wire adapter (provided with a new unit) when making a thermocouple reading or sourcing a thermocouple temperature signal. They are color coded. The Fluke manual has a table showing some of the different country thermocouple color codes.

There can be an error of multiple degrees when a T/C jack/leadwire that is not the same temperature as the calibrator is connected. The manual says, "wait one minute or more for the connector temperature to stabilize after you plug the miniplug into the TC input/output." This is to allow the CJ temperature sensor to adapt to the connector's temperature. One minute might not be enough, depending on the difference in temperature. Any difference in temperature between the jack and the calibrator is a direct error in the reading or the output of the calibrator. A 5 degree difference is a 5 degree error. Not good for people who think they're getting a ±1° calibration.

If the jack/leadwire adapters are missing, you can easily make your own using a standard Thermocouple Mini jack (available from any controls vendor) and a length of the same type thermocouple wire.

That Fluke model will do steps or ramps for cal checks at specfic temperature intervals.

That Fluke model will read mA but does not source a mA signal.
